Grasping Registered Agents' Roles in the State of Washington
A legal representative in Washington is an person or business entity that is appointed to accept legal papers on behalf of a business. This role is vital for maintaining conformity with state laws, as registered agents guarantee that businesses can be located by the government and other entities in the event of lawsuits or notices. Having a trustworthy registered agent helps to protect the company's legal status and facilitates smoother operations.
In the State of Washington, the registered agent must have a physical address within the state, where they can be present during business hours to accept service of process, alerts, and other official papers. This condition ensures that the representative is reachable and that important notices are not overlooked. Whether it is a business service or an agent, fulfilling this requirement is important for the effective running of any company operating in the State of Washington.

Fees and Fees of WA Agent Services
When choosing a registered agent in Washington, understanding the price and charges associated with these services is essential for businesses of all types. Typically, the annual charges for registered agent services in Washington vary from $200 to $300, depending on the service level provided. Some agents may offer extra features, such as alerts for compliance and mail forwarding, which can impact the overall price. It is important to evaluate various firms to ensure you are receiving the optimal value for your needs.
In addition to the standard yearly fees, some registered agents in WA may charge extra for specific services, such as filing annual reports or providing a real address for law-related communications. These extra fees can differ widely among providers. Consequently, businesses should carefully review the pricing structures of various registered agent services to spot any concealed costs that could affect their overall budget.

Annual Compliance and Documentation Requirements
In Washington, businesses are obligated to adhere to certain annual regulatory and reporting obligations to maintain good standing with local authorities. One of the main obligations is the submission of the Annual Report, which provides current information about the company's standing, structure, and communication details. This report is typically required on the final day of the month in which the business was formed, and failure to file on time can lead to penalties and even loss of business status.
Registered agents play a vital role in making sure that these compliance dates are met. They are responsible for handling legal papers and notifications from the government, including reminders for the Annual Report filing. This allows company owners to focus on their operations, being assured that their registered agent will ensure them informed of critical compliance matters. Online & Virtual Agency Services
In today's digital era, many companies in the state of Washington are selecting for digital and online agent services. These solutions provide a modern solution for LLCs and companies looking to maintain compliance without the need for a brick-and-mortar office. Virtual agents offer digital platforms where company owners can organize important files, receive notifications, and address compliance requirements directly from their laptops or smartphones. This ease is especially advantageous for small businesses and new ventures that may not require a full-time in-person presence.
Choosing a virtual virtual agent can also be a affordable option. Many online services offer competitive rates, often with packages that include additional services like mail forwarding, compliance notifications, and document storage. By utilizing these solutions, business operators can save on overhead costs related to maintaining a physical location while making sure they fulfill all statutory requirements. It also reduces the risk of missing critical communications, which can lead to penalties or lapses in compliance.
Moreover, online virtual agents enhance the privacy and safety of business operators. Many businesses prefer not to use their personal addresses for official records, making online agents an attractive choice. These solutions can provide a specific business address to use for legal documents and serve as a contact address for service of process. This not only helps in upholding a professional image but also shields business operators from unwanted solicitation or court papers being served at their home residences.
Modifying The Appointed Agent in Washington
Modifying the registered agent within Washington can be a simple procedure which ensures your company stays compliant to local regulations. To start the modification, you must choose a different registered agent that fulfills the State of Washington's requirements. This agent must have a physical address in the region and be available during normal business hours to accept legal notices. As soon as you have appointed the new appointed agent, you must to prepare the required documents to inform the authorities regarding this modification.
The main form for this procedure is the Change of Registered Agent application, which you can download from the Secretary of State of Washington's website. Fill out the application including the required details, including the business name, the title of the existing appointed agent, and the details of the new agent. After completing the form, you must submit it together with the required fee to the office of the Secretary of State. This action is crucial to guarantee that records are refreshed, and your updated registered agent is formally acknowledged.
Once you have filed the change, it is prudent to inform your former registered agent regarding the switch and ensure that they do not represent your business. Additionally, revise your records and notify any interested parties, including financial institutions or customers, of your new appointed agent's contact information. Making these changes helps maintain the smooth functioning of your business and guarantees that you do not overlook any important alerts or official communications moving forward.
